Chronopharmaceutical drug delivery systems: Hurdles, hype or hope?

Bi-Botti C Youan1.   

Abstract

The current advances in chronobiology and the knowledge gained from chronotherapy of selected diseases strongly suggest that "the one size fits all at all times" approach to drug delivery is no longer substantiated, at least for selected bioactive agents and disease therapy or prevention. Thus, there is a critical and urgent need for chronopharmaceutical research (e.g., design and evaluation of robust, spatially and temporally controlled drug delivery systems that would be clinically intended for chronotherapy by different routes of administration). This review provides a brief overview of current drug delivery system intended for chronotherapy. In theory, such an ideal "magic pill" preferably with affordable cost, would improve the safety, efficacy and patient compliance of old and new drugs. However, currently, there are three major hurdles for the successful transition of such system from laboratory to patient bedside. These include the challenges to identify adequate (i) rhythmic biomaterials and systems, (ii) rhythm engineering and modeling, perhaps using system biology and (iii) regulatory guidance. 2010 Elsevier B.V.
